What are the best practices for Agile reporting?
Agile reporting is the process of communicating the progress, performance, and value of Agile projects to various stakeholders, such as customers, managers, team members, and sponsors. Agile reporting aims to provide timely, accurate, and relevant information that supports decision-making, feedback, and improvement. However, Agile reporting can also pose some challenges, such as choosing the right metrics, tools, and formats, balancing transparency and confidentiality, and adapting to changing requirements and expectations.
